f(x) = y = 3x/(8 + x) (I am assuming that the 8 + x is the denominator. Please use parentheses in the future if you forgot this. If there are no parentheses, then my solution will not work for you.)
Exchange x and y; that is, replace x by y and y by x simultaneously:
x = 3y/(8 + y).
Then use algebra to solve for y in terms of x:
(8 + y)x = 3y (multiply both sides by the denominator to clear the fraction)
8x + xy = 3y (distribute)
xy − 3y = −8x (rearrange terms with all y's on the left side of the equation)
y(x − 3) = −8x (factor out y as a common factor)
y = −8x/(x − 3) (divide by x − 3)
Finally, replace y by f-1(x):
f-1(x) = −8x/(x − 3).
This is the inverse of f(x). It can be checked by finding f(f-1(x)) and f-1(f(x)), and verifying that both equal x after simplifying.
